Sophora Flavescens Root Extract

Also known as: Sophora flavescens Aiton, Kushen, Sophora root, Ku Shen, Sophora flavescens

Overview

Sophora flavescens root extract is derived from the dried roots of the Sophora flavescens plant, a staple in traditional Chinese medicine (TCM). It's recognized for its anti-inflammatory, antimicrobial, and anticancer properties. Primarily, it's used to manage inflammatory conditions, skin disorders, and gastrointestinal issues, and as an adjunctive therapy for cancer-related symptoms. The extract contains bioactive alkaloids, notably matrine and oxymatrine, which are believed to drive its pharmacological effects. Research is growing, with increasing randomized controlled trials (RCTs) and systematic reviews focusing on its efficacy in ulcerative colitis, neuropathic pain from tumor metastasis, and dermatological conditions. However, the quality of evidence varies, with some heterogeneity and regional bias, mainly from studies in China. It is available in various forms, including capsules, powders, and topical creams.

Benefits

Sophora flavescens root extract offers several evidence-based benefits. It significantly reduces bone neuropathic pain induced by tumor metastasis, supported by meta-analytic evidence for its adjunctive use in cancer pain management. It also improves ulcerative colitis (UC) symptoms, demonstrating efficacy comparable to conventional medicine without increasing adverse events. Its anti-inflammatory and antimicrobial effects are beneficial in skin disorders and oral infections, supported by systematic reviews in dental applications. Secondary benefits include potential anticancer properties through bioactive alkaloids, though clinical validation is needed, and possible benefits in treating diarrhea and vaginal itching due to antimicrobial activity. These benefits are particularly relevant for cancer patients with bone metastasis-related pain, individuals with inflammatory bowel disease (specifically ulcerative colitis), and those with dermatological infections or inflammatory conditions.

How it works

Sophora flavescens exerts its effects through multiple biological pathways. Its anti-inflammatory action involves inhibiting pro-inflammatory cytokines and pathways. Antimicrobial effects stem from disrupting microbial cell membranes. Anticancer properties are possibly mediated by inducing apoptosis and inhibiting tumor cell proliferation via alkaloids like matrine and oxymatrine. It modulates the immune response and inflammatory signaling, acts on the nervous system to alleviate neuropathic pain, and influences gastrointestinal mucosa healing and immune modulation in UC. Molecular targets include cytokines such as TNF-α and IL-6, and signaling pathways involved in apoptosis and inflammation, such as NF-κB. The alkaloids are absorbed orally, but bioavailability varies, requiring further pharmacokinetic study.

Side effects

Sophora flavescens is generally well-tolerated in short-term use, with no significant increase in adverse events compared to controls in UC trials. Common side effects (occurring in >5% of users) include mild gastrointestinal discomfort. Uncommon side effects (1-5%) may include allergic reactions or skin rash. Rare side effects (<1%) include potential interactions with chemotherapy agents, necessitating caution. Drug interactions are possible with chemotherapeutic drugs, requiring careful monitoring. Contraindications are not well-established, but caution is advised during pregnancy and lactation due to limited data. Cancer patients should use it under medical supervision due to potential interactions. Data are limited in pediatric and elderly populations. Overall, while generally safe, monitoring for adverse reactions and potential interactions is crucial, especially in vulnerable populations.

Dosage

Dosage guidelines for Sophora flavescens are not standardized and vary by formulation and indication. Clinical trials have used varied doses, but standardized extracts containing defined alkaloid content are commonly preferred. The minimum effective dose is not well-defined. The maximum safe dose is also not clearly defined, but safety has been established in short-term use. Typically, it is administered orally, but the timing relative to meals is not well-defined. Extracts standardized for matrine/oxymatrine content are common. Bioavailability may be influenced by formulation, and lipophilic alkaloids may require specific delivery systems. There are no established required cofactors. It's important to adhere to product-specific instructions and consult with a healthcare professional to determine the appropriate dosage.

FAQs

Is Sophora flavescens safe for long-term use?

Long-term safety data are limited. Short-term use appears safe under supervision, but further research is needed to establish long-term safety profiles.

Can it be used alongside chemotherapy?

Potential interactions exist with chemotherapy drugs. Medical supervision is essential to monitor for adverse effects and adjust treatment accordingly.

How soon can benefits be expected?

Clinical improvements have been observed within weeks in ulcerative colitis and pain management studies, but individual responses may vary.

Is it effective for all inflammatory conditions?

Evidence supports its use for specific conditions like ulcerative colitis and skin infections. Generalizing its effectiveness to all inflammatory conditions is premature without further research.

Research Sources

  • https://pmc.ncbi.nlm.nih.gov/articles/PMC11611551/ – This meta-analysis of multiple RCTs, primarily from China, found that Sophora flavescens significantly reduced neuropathic pain when used as an adjunct therapy for tumor-induced bone pain. However, the study acknowledges limitations including regional and publication bias, as well as a lack of long-term safety data, suggesting the need for more diverse and comprehensive research.
  • https://pubmed.ncbi.nlm.nih.gov/35069773/ – A systematic review and meta-analysis of RCTs demonstrated that Sophora flavescens extract has comparable efficacy to conventional treatments for ulcerative colitis, without increasing adverse events. This supports its potential use as an alternative or adjunct therapy in managing ulcerative colitis, offering a potentially safer option for patients.
  • https://www.frontiersin.org/journals/pharmacology/articles/10.3389/fphar.2020.603476/full – This review summarizes the clinical efficacy and mechanisms of Sophora flavescens in various conditions, highlighting its anti-inflammatory, antimicrobial, and anticancer properties, which are mediated by its alkaloids. The authors emphasize the need for further high-quality clinical trials to validate these findings and explore broader clinical applications.
